Meaning & origin

Jamason appears to be a modern coinage, blending the established name James with the fashionable -son suffix. First recorded in 1972, the name saw its peak in 2012, when it was given to a handful of boys across the United States. Its trajectory has remained stable in the years since, never reaching the popularity of similar names like Mason or Jackson. The name has not been concentrated in any particular state, suggesting sporadic use nationwide. Jamason fits a naming trend that transforms surnames into first names, giving it a familiar yet distinctive feel.

Jamason is a modern English surname transferred to given name use, derived from the medieval given name James plus the patronymic suffix -son. It follows the pattern of other -son names like Jackson and Mason, though it remains less common. The name James itself comes from the Hebrew Jacob, meaning 'supplanter.'

Nicknames & variants

Nicknames: Jay, Jam, Sonny

Variants: Jameson, Jamison
